Fort Rajwada is indeed a nice property, followed by Gorbandh,Rang Mahal & Heritage inn. Killa Bhawan is a small property with tastefully decorated rooms on Fort ramparts. The views from the rooms are good. It is being run by a French. Rawal Kot is a Taj hotel, with fine views of the fort. Some of the rooms on the top floor are very nice in comparison to those which are in the basement. However, it is far away from the city centre.
The problem with some of the fine properties which are not managed by renowned hotel groups is that the services are less professionally managed. The boys will bend backwards to please you, but do not have formal training in management.

I stayed at Fort Rajwada and really liked it. The rooms with a view of the fort are great. As the last poster said it is not in the fort. But of the hotels in the area I think it is hard to go wrong here.

If i were to go back I would like to stay in the fort complex -- definetly a step down, but would be an interesting experience.
